package gitlab import ( glb "github.com/xanzy/go-gitlab" ) type GitlabProject struct { client *glb.Client path string MergeRequests []*glb.MergeRequest Issues []*glb.Issue RemoteProject *glb.Project } func NewGitlabProject(projectPath string, client *glb.Client) *GitlabProject { project := GitlabProject{ client: client, path: projectPath, } return &project } // Refresh reloads the gitlab data via the Gitlab API func (project *GitlabProject) Refresh() { project.MergeRequests, _ = project.loadMergeRequests() project.RemoteProject, _ = project.loadRemoteProject() project.Issues, _ = project.loadIssues() } /* -------------------- Counts -------------------- */ func (project *GitlabProject) IssueCount() int { if project.RemoteProject == nil { return 0 } return project.RemoteProject.OpenIssuesCount } func (project *GitlabProject) MergeRequestCount() int { return len(project.MergeRequests) } func (project *GitlabProject) StarCount() int { if project.RemoteProject == nil { return 0 } return project.RemoteProject.StarCount } /* -------------------- Unexported Functions -------------------- */ // myMergeRequests returns a list of merge requests created by username on this project func (project *GitlabProject) myMergeRequests(username string) []*glb.MergeRequest { mrs := []*glb.MergeRequest{} for _, mr := range project.MergeRequests { user := mr.Author if user.Username == username { mrs = append(mrs, mr) } } return mrs } // myApprovalRequests returns a list of merge requests for which username has been // requested to approve func (project *GitlabProject) myApprovalRequests(username string) []*glb.MergeRequest { mrs := []*glb.MergeRequest{} for _, mr := range project.MergeRequests { approvers, _, err := project.client.MergeRequests.GetMergeRequestApprovals(project.path, mr.IID) if err != nil { continue } for _, approver := range approvers.Approvers { if approver.User.Username == username { mrs = append(mrs, mr) } } } return mrs } // myAssignedIssues returns a list of issues for which username has been assigned func (project *GitlabProject) myAssignedIssues(username string) []*glb.Issue { issues := []*glb.Issue{} for _, issue := range project.Issues { if issue.Assignee != nil && issue.Assignee.Username == username { issues = append(issues, issue) } } return issues } // myIssues returns a list of issues created by username on this project func (project *GitlabProject) myIssues(username string) []*glb.Issue { issues := []*glb.Issue{} for _, issue := range project.Issues { if issue.Author.Username == username { issues = append(issues, issue) } } return issues } func (project *GitlabProject) loadMergeRequests() ([]*glb.MergeRequest, error) { state := "opened" opts := glb.ListProjectMergeRequestsOptions{ State: &state, } mrs, _, err := project.client.MergeRequests.ListProjectMergeRequests(project.path, &opts) if err != nil { return nil, err } return mrs, nil } func (project *GitlabProject) loadIssues() ([]*glb.Issue, error) { state := "opened" opts := glb.ListProjectIssuesOptions{ State: &state, } issues, _, err := project.client.Issues.ListProjectIssues(project.path, &opts) if err != nil { return nil, err } return issues, nil } func (project *GitlabProject) loadRemoteProject() (*glb.Project, error) { projectsitory, _, err := project.client.Projects.GetProject(project.path, nil) if err != nil { return nil, err } return projectsitory, nil }
